Advanced Brain and Body Clinic is Hiring a Medical Office Manager Near Golden Valley, MN

Advanced Brain and Body Clinic, a psychiatry office located in Golden Valley, MN, is currently accepting resumes for the position of Office Manager. The successful candidate will be adept at supervising day-to-day operations that keep our office running with smooth efficiency. Administration duties will include managing people, business and financial resources. Strong analytical, organizational, adaptive and interpersonal skills and abilities are required.

Responsibilities Include:

  • Managing the daily operations of the office
  • Supervise, train and support staff in office policy; provide instruction and corrective action when required
  • Assist providers as needed
  • Interface between support staff and providers
  • Ensure compliance with office patient financial policy and laws
  • Track and monitor data and metrics that assist in measuring the financial health of the business
  • Work closely with our Management Services Organization developing and resolving patient accounts, insurance carrier/plans, employee and organizational challenges
  • Become a Super-User of our EMR System (Advanced MD)
  • Oversee patient prior authorizations for medications and treatment
  • Research and evaluate eligibility for patient appointments and treatments
  • Compile and forward medical records for insurance requests and/or subpoenas in accordance with HIPAA guidelines
  • Maintain office files (electronic)
  • Work with the MSO in hiring, onboarding, ensuring compliance and all other aspects of the employee experience
  • Take initiative to improve processes, maintain and update Policies and Procedures Manual
  • Represent our business in a professional manner
  • Demonstrate exemplary customer service
  • Arrange for and staff promotional civic events
  • Attend workshops and professional conferences
  • Ensure a professional and positive work culture; demonstrate respect for all
  • Additional responsibilities and duties as needed and requested

Requirements:

  • Three years office management experience, preferably in the medical field
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ills
  • Computer proficiency with Microsoft Office 365, with emphasis in Word and Excel
  • Experience and proficiency with EHRs (Electronic Health Records)
  • Analytical and resourceful problem solving skills
  • Excellent organizational and prioritizing skills
  • Knowledge of HIPAA, OSHA and other compliance regulations
  • Disciplined, determined, dedicated
  • Capable of multi-tasking and self-starting
  • Exemplary customer service skills, work ethic, integrity and professionalism that demonstrates leadership by example
  • Must have an optimistic outlook and positive energy

Education:

  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ited institution
